Output d53144e44f26a8d97a3435a93b26d1f39e327942ef81293aa556c1815aafd091:0

value
19812
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 c7d8cb0fb2243b6dc049a921a06ee09fecad9152 OP_EQUALVERIFY OP_CHECKSIG
address
1KDhBENBo5mgh6GGvGpijfNn8j9B1noFqF
transaction
d53144e44f26a8d97a3435a93b26d1f39e327942ef81293aa556c1815aafd091
confirmations
253606
spent
true